“The Southpaw” from The Manila Machine
LA’s favorite Filipino food truck, The Manila Machine, is serving up a special sandwich this week in honor of Filipino boxer and national icon Manny Pacquiao, who will be fighting Antonio Margarito tomorrow.
The sandwich, dubbed The Southpaw (Pacquiao is left-handed), is an open-faced toasted pan de sal roll topped with The Manila Machine’s signature sisig (spicy calamansi-marinated pork jowls), sriracha mayo, crumbled chicharon, onions, a fried egg, banana ketchup, and a bonus drizzle of sriracha for good measure.

Fried Egg Sandwich with Sriracha Aioli – Heather John, The Foodinista, considers herself a bit of an expert on fried egg sandwiches, and looking at the picture of this masterpiece, spiked with Sriracha aioli, I’d have to agree. A perfectly fried egg on multi-grain bread topped with spicy greens like arugula, thin slices of Gruyère cheese, and a healthy squirt of Sriracha mayo… breakfast of champions. (Pardon the cliché.)
